Description

Shipping electronic parts within a factory, to another factory, distributor, or to an end-user has always been an area of uncertainty within the manufacturing process. To provide clear-cut information on what type of controlled packaging should be used in any situation, the ESD Association has recently released a comprehensive revision of the obsolete industry standard EIA 541-1988. The new document, ESD S541, is the focus of this session. It provides information and guidance, as well as material specifications, to assist in the design and implementation of a packaging plan for use within an ANSI/ESD S20.20 based ESD control program. Current and newly released test method standards suitable for packaging material evaluation will be described. Course credit applies to the ESD Certified Professional-Program Manager certification curriculum.
